• Thread Author
Microsoft’s security update guide lists a high‑risk elevation‑of‑privilege entry for the Windows MBT Transport driver that, according to the vendor advisory, stems from an untrusted pointer dereference and can be used by an authorized local user to escalate to SYSTEM — a kernel‑level impact that demands immediate attention from administrators and security teams.

A futuristic security shield glows on a circuit board with a red warning symbol.Background / Overview​

The MBT Transport driver is the Windows kernel component commonly known as netbt.sys, the NetBIOS‑over‑TCP/IP (NetBT) driver that implements legacy NetBIOS name and session services layered on top of TCP/IP. NetBT remains present on many desktop, server and legacy application environments for backward compatibility and is therefore an attractive target for local privilege escalation if a kernel flaw exists in its implementation. The driver binary appears in Windows driver inventories as MBT Transport driver (netbt.sys).
Kernel drivers that mediate networking or file system operations are especially sensitive. They run in ring‑0 and are reachable from ordinary user‑mode APIs, device IOCTLs and common service interfaces. Small pointer‑validation errors, race conditions or integer arithmetic faults in these code paths can escalate from simple crashes into reliable EoP primitives when combined with allocation manipulation, timing control, or other local primitives attackers routinely use. Independent analysis and post‑patch reporting for Windows kernel driver CVEs in 2024–2025 show this pattern repeatedly.

What Microsoft’s advisory—and the public record—say​

Microsoft’s Update Guide entry referenced by the user identifies a vulnerability in the MBT Transport driver that allows a locally authorized attacker to elevate privileges via an untrusted pointer dereference. The vendor entry is the authoritative mapping of CVE to KBs and patched file versions and should be the primary source for exact remediation metadata in enterprises.
Independent security trackers and reporting from the July 2025 Patch Tuesday cycle list an MBT Transport driver vulnerability with the same operational profile (local EoP) and provide supplemental details. Multiple third‑party summaries characterize a related MBT fix as addressing an integer underflow or arithmetic wrap/underflow condition in the MBT driver that could cause insufficient buffer allocation and memory corruption, which attackers could convert into privilege escalation. Those independent write‑ups and vulnerability databases document the same affected component (netbt.sys / MBT Transport) and the same operational severity (Important / local EoP). (zeropath.com, thewindowsupdate.com)
Important verification note: public trackers sometimes list closely related CVE numbers for the same general driver family or for separate but conceptually similar bugs in a short calendar window. At the time of writing, major summaries and vulnerability databases widely referenced an MBT driver CVE tied to an integer underflow (for example, CVE‑2025‑47996) while the MSRC vendor URL you provided is listed under CVE‑2025‑55230. The vendor’s MSRC entry is the canonical record for Microsoft’s fixed builds and KB mappings; however, the precise CVE number referenced in third‑party trackers may differ during initial propagation. Treat MSRC’s advisory as authoritative for patch identification while watching NVD, Rapid7, and major security outlets to confirm cross‑indexing and public exploit analysis. (msrc.microsoft.com, rapid7.com, bleepingcomputer.com)

Technical analysis: what “untrusted pointer dereference” implies for netbt.sys​

Root cause classes and exploit primitives​

An untrusted pointer dereference occurs when kernel code reads or writes memory via a pointer derived from user‑supplied data or insufficiently validated kernel state. At first glance this can simply cause a crash (denial‑of‑service), but in kernel mode, attackers have long demonstrated ways to turn such faults into memory‑corruption primitives:
  • Control allocation size and timing to influence what kernel object occupies freed or null regions.
  • Use allocation spraying or deterministic allocator patterns to place attacker‑controlled objects in predictable places.
  • Combine the error with information leaks or other local primitives to gain arbitrary read/write or function pointer overwrite capabilities.
  • Overwrite process tokens or credential structures to obtain NT AUTHORITY\SYSTEM privileges.
When the vulnerable component is netbt.sys, those primitives are powerful because NetBIOS services are accessible from many user contexts and are executed in kernel mode. The difference between a crash and an EoP exploit comes down to attacker skill, available local primitives, and how predictable kernel allocations can be made on the target host.

Alternative characterization: integer underflow reports​

Multiple independent write‑ups that cover July 2025 Patch Tuesday describe the MBT driver fix as addressing an integer underflow condition (an arithmetic wraparound leading to an incorrectly small allocation and subsequent buffer corruption). An integer underflow and an untrusted pointer dereference are different programming faults, but they are not mutually exclusive in practical exploit chains: an arithmetic underflow can create a size that leads to a missing buffer or NULL pointer scenario which an attacker then dereferences or corrupts. This is why public reporting may use different technical labels for closely related driver fixes. Security teams should treat both patterns as high‑impact kernel risks and act on the patch guidance rather than debating labels. (zeropath.com, rapid7.com)

Affected systems and deployment guidance​

Third‑party vulnerability databases and Patch Tuesday roundups list the MBT Transport driver issue among the kernel and networking fixes distributed in that month’s updates. Enterprise patch metadata reported mappings across a broad range of Windows SKUs: multiple Windows 10 and Windows 11 feature updates and Windows Server builds were included in the remediation set described in vendor summaries. Administrators must consult the MSRC entry (the authoritative vendor mapping) to retrieve the exact KB numbers that match their OS builds and to pull the appropriate cumulative update packages. (msrc.microsoft.com, rapid7.com)
Practical deployment priorities:
  • Prioritize multi‑user machines (RDS/VDI hosts), developer build systems, and shared workstations where low‑privileged local code execution is most likely.
  • Patch Hyper‑V hosts and management consoles promptly if they run vulnerable builds and expose local admin or management roles to non‑trusted users.
  • Map and validate the driver file version (netbt.sys) across your estate after patching to confirm the update applied successfully; driver metadata and timestamp changes are reliable indicators that the patch is present.

Detection and monitoring recommendations​

Because kernel‑level EoP attempts are subtle and often timing‑dependent, detection is nontrivial. Recommended monitoring signals and hunts include:
  • Kernel telemetry alerts on modifications to driver objects for netbt.sys or unusual kernel allocation patterns near network driver execution. Use Defender for Endpoint kernel sensors or third‑party EDR kernel telemetry where available.
  • EDR rules to flag repeated, rapid DeviceIoControl / IOCTL calls against MBT / NetBT device interfaces initiated by non‑privileged processes.
  • Hunting for processes that perform tight syscall loops targeting network stack operations (attackers attempting to “win” a timing race often drive high‑frequency system calls).
  • Post‑escalation indicators: unexpected LSASS memory access, unsigned driver loads, new persistence artifacts (scheduled tasks, service installs), and abnormal outbound connections consistent with command‑and‑control.
If a host is suspected to have been exploited, assume kernel‑level compromise: collect volatile memory, kernel crash dumps, and full EDR traces; isolate the device and plan for reimaging after forensic capture because kernel implants are difficult to eradicate with confidence.

Mitigation options (short term and medium term)​

  • Apply the vendor security update immediately
  • Use the MSRC Security Update Guide entry to map the CVE to the cumulative update / KB that matches your Windows build and architecture. The MSRC entry is the canonical mapping for corporate patch workflows.
  • If rapid patching is not possible, consider temporary surface‑reduction steps
  • Where feasible, disable NetBIOS over TCP/IP on endpoints that do not require NetBIOS services. This reduces exposure to the netbt.sys attack surface for non‑legacy applications. Microsoft documentation and standard admin guides describe how to disable NetBIOS over TCP/IP via DHCP options, network adapter advanced TCP/IPv4 → WINS tab or via Group Policy/registry automation for larger fleets. This is a pragmatic but potentially disruptive mitigation — test thoroughly because some legacy apps rely on NetBIOS name resolution.
  • Enforce stricter local execution controls: application control policies (AppLocker / Windows Defender Application Control) and least‑privilege models to reduce the chance an attacker can run the exploit payload locally.
  • Hardening and monitoring
  • Enable Memory Integrity / HVCI where supported to raise exploitation difficulty on modern hardware.
  • Tune EDR for the patterns above and increase kernel telemetry sampling on high‑value hosts.
  • Maintain a prioritized patching ring for RDS/VDI, developer machines, and administrative workstations.
  • Incident readiness
  • If an exploit is suspected, perform full forensic collection (volatile memory, kernel dumps), isolate the host, and prepare for reimaging. Kernel compromises require high confidence in remediation and evidence capture.

Operational risk and likely attacker scenarios​

The attacker model for this class of flaw is local and authorized: an attacker must be able to run code on the target. That prerequisite is nontrivial but commonly achieved in real incidents via phishing, malicious installers, or supply‑chain malware. Once local code execution is obtained, the combination of readily automatable race attempts, allocator control techniques, and known kernel exploitation methods makes turning a null dereference or underflow into an EoP path practical for skilled adversaries. Historical windows show that once a reproducible primitive is discovered, exploit reliability increases quickly.
High‑risk deployment types where this EoP is especially damaging:
  • Remote Desktop / Terminal Servers and VDI hosts where many non‑admin users co‑exist.
  • Developer build machines that run unvetted scripts and third‑party tools.
  • Shared administrative consoles or jump hosts where a single escalated account can vault across infrastructure.
Because kernel escalation to SYSTEM is a universal pivot to persistence, credential theft, and lateral movement, defenders should treat this vulnerability as time‑sensitive.

Cross‑verification and uncertainty notice​

  • Vendor authority: the Microsoft Security Update Guide entry for the CVE referenced by the user is the authoritative source for the patched KBs and per‑OS guidance; map the MSRC advisory to your environment first.
  • Public trackers: multiple independent sources documented an MBT Transport driver fix in the same update window, frequently referenced as CVE‑2025‑47996 (integer underflow) in third‑party reports and vulnerability databases, and listed alongside other kernel networking fixes in Patch Tuesday roundups. This cross‑coverage corroborates the high‑priority nature of MBT driver patches. (zeropath.com, rapid7.com)
  • Unverifiable claim flagged: the specific CVE identifier you provided (CVE‑2025‑55230) appears on the MSRC vendor page but, at the time of analysis, does not yet appear widely propagated across several public vulnerability databases and media summaries that used CVE‑2025‑47996 for the MBT driver fix. This inconsistency is common during initial CVE propagation or when vendors split or renumber related fixes. Use MSRC as the canonical source for remediation mapping and track NVD / Rapid7 / BleepingComputer entries for cross‑indexing and public exploit write‑ups. (msrc.microsoft.com, bleepingcomputer.com)

Strengths and weaknesses of the response ecosystem​

Vendor strengths​

  • Microsoft’s centralized MSRC Security Update Guide provides KB mappings and per‑SKU guidance, enabling administrators to perform accurate patch testing and deployment. The vendor’s rapid update cadence for kernel issues in 2024–2025 shows responsiveness in rolling mitigations.

Ecosystem weaknesses and operational gaps​

  • Public indexing lag and CVE propagation differences among vendor, NVD and third‑party trackers can cause confusion for patch managers mapping CVE → KB → build. This can delay targeted rollout in constrained change windows.
  • Enterprise patch inertia: incomplete rollouts leave pockets of unpatched systems for weeks, creating a window where proof‑of‑concepts (PoCs) or weaponized exploits can inflict disproportionate damage once published. Vendor advisories must be acted on quickly and verified in production.
  • Kernel codebase complexity and legacy compatibility pressures make it hard to avoid subtle concurrency and pointer‑validation mistakes; this means similar classes of bugs will likely recur unless testing and fuzzing coverage grows significantly.

Step‑by‑step remediation checklist for IT ops (recommended sequence)​

  • Consult MSRC and map your builds to the precise KB listed in the vendor advisory. Prioritize host groups by risk (RDS/VDI, dev, admin consoles).
  • Stage the cumulative update in a test ring; validate application and confirm netbt.sys file metadata (version/timestamp) changed as expected.
  • Deploy to prioritized rings and monitor for rollback or compatibility hits.
  • For systems that cannot be patched immediately:
  • Disable NetBIOS over TCP/IP where possible and safe to do so. Use DHCP option, adapter TCP/IPv4 → WINS setting, or Group Policy to push the change. Test impact on network drives and legacy services before broad rollout.
  • Tighten local execution controls and restrict the ability of non‑admin users to install/run arbitrary software.
  • Tune EDR and SIEM to hunt for IOCTL/DeviceIoControl anomalies and kernel allocation spikes near netbt.sys activity. Collect suspicious hosts for forensic capture.
  • If exploitation is suspected, isolate the host, collect volatile memory and kernel dumps, and plan reimaging following evidence capture. Assume a kernel compromise may require full rebuild.

Conclusion​

The MBT Transport driver vulnerability that Microsoft lists in its security update guide is a kernel‑level local elevation‑of‑privilege risk with systemic implications for any environment that retains NetBIOS/NetBT functionality. While public trackers and media summarized a related MBT fix as an integer underflow (widely reported under a different CVE in the same update window), the vendor’s MSRC record remains the authoritative source for KB mapping and should be used to drive enterprise patching.
Actionable priorities for defenders are clear: treat the MBT/netbt.sys update as high priority, verify the correct KBs for your OS builds in MSRC, patch RDS/VDI and developer hosts first, enable targeted EDR hunts for IOCTL and kernel allocation anomalies, and, where safe, reduce the attack surface by disabling NetBIOS over TCP/IP until patches roll out. Given the historical speed with which kernel primitives are weaponized once triggers become public, the best defense is prompt, validated patching and focused detection readiness. (msrc.microsoft.com, rapid7.com, learn.microsoft.com)

Source: MSRC Security Update Guide - Microsoft Security Response Center
 

Back
Top